Duluth, MN (11-19-18) – Orthopaedic Associates of Duluth is offering a free fall prevention and balance class for those interested in learning how to prevent falls, what exercises are best to prevent falls, and what to do in case of a fall.

During the class, participants will learn to view falls and fear of falling as controllable, set realistic goals to increase activity, change their environment to reduce fall risk factors, and exercises to increase strength and balance. Fall risk assessments will also be available on site to determine the level of risk for falls and which, if any, assistive device is necessary when walking.

Older adult falls are a leading cause of injuries, disability, and death.  Evidence has shown that participation in balance/strength classes prevents falls.
